Nationals star and 2021 second round pick James Wood is competing in the derby. He is part of a stacked field that will be taking center stage at Truist Park.
The Nationals have given Wood his first career game off at the MLB level on the final day before the All-Star break. For good reason, too: Wood will let it rip in the Home Run Derby on Monday night in Atlanta. The Nationals have chartered a plane for their All Stars, Wood and MacKenzie Gore, to head to Atlanta in style.
The Nationals' stellar second-year outfielder made an impression during his Home Run Derby debut with a majestic blast.
When they let Rizzo go, the Nationals bid adieu to a figure who had seen almost the entire history of the franchise in D.C.. Washington hired Rizzo before the 2007 season, the team's third after its relocation from Montreal. Several former Montreal Expos and Expos draftees were on the roster at that point.
Mike Rizzo, a former Nationals executive, offered to buy fans' drinks before this year's Home Run Derby, adding he had "no regrets" about his 16-year tenure.

Unlike typical regular-season and postseason MLB games, the All-Star Game does not feature extra innings. Instead, the leagues came up with an even more interesting way to determine a winner if the game is knotted up after nine innings: another Home Run Derby.
